Speckle Image Reconstruction. Appendix 2
Abstract
Partial contents: Size Measurement of a Geosynchronous Satellite Using the MMT (Multiple Mirror Telescope); Speckle Interferometry of Asteroids; High-Speed Digital Signal Processing for Speckle Interferometry; Seeing Calibration of Optical Astronomical Speckle Interferometric Data; Seeing Studies for Speckle Holographic Imaging; A self Calibrating Shift-and-Add Technique for Speckle Imaging; Physical Diameter and Images of Alpha Orionis; Image Reconstruction from Astronomical Speckle Interferometry; Recovery of Binary Star Orientation and Relative Intensity--A comparison of Techniques; Maximum Magnitude Estimation of Object's Power Spectrum In Stellar Speckle Interferometry; The Differential Speckle Interferometer; Statistical Analysis of the Self-Calibrating Shift-and-Add Image Reconstruction Technique; Adaptive Optics.
